Configuring MV90 Extendable Lookups
Note:
This section applies to both middleware and native implementations of the Smart Grid Gateway MV90 Adapter for Itron.
This section outlines some of the extendable lookups that must be configured for use with the MV-90 Adapter for Itron. Refer to the Oracle Utilities Application Framework documentation for more information about working with extendable lookups.
Interval Status Code to Event Mapping
The MV-90 adapter for does not accept device events from an MV-90 system, but can create device events based on specific interval status codes in an incoming usage reading. The MV-90 Interval Status Code to Event Mapping extendable lookup is used to determine which type of device event business object to instantiate when creating device events based on interval status codes received with usage from the MV-90 system.
Each value defined for the Interval Status Code to Event Mapping extendable lookup should include the following:
MV90 Interval Status: The interval status code used by the MV-90 system
Description: A description of the MV-90 interval status code
Event Duration Mode: The duration type for the event. Can be either “Individual” or “Continuous” (used for events with a duration, such as an outage).
Device Event Type: The Device Event Type for the device event created for this interval status code. For status codes with an Event Duration Mode or “Continuous” this is the start event, or the first of the paired events created for this status code.
End Event Type: The Device Event Type for the “end” device event created for this interval status code. For status codes with an Event Duration Mode or “Continuous” this is the start event, or the last of the paired events created for this status code.
Example: The MV-90 “Low Voltage” status code could be configured to create a “Low Voltage” device event as follows:
MV90 Interval Status: <MV-90 interval status code for low voltage>
Description: Low Voltage detected for meter
Event Duration Mode: Individual
Device Event Type: Low Voltage
End Event Type: N/A
Example: The MV-90 “Power Outage” status code could be configured to create a “Last Gasp” device event, and a “Power Restoration” event as follows:
MV90 Interval Status: <MV-90 interval status code for outage>
Description: Outage
Event Duration Mode: Continuous
Device Event Type: Last Gasp
End Event Type: Power Restoration
UOM Code to Standard UOM Code Mapping
Usage received from a utility’s head-end system may use utility-specific unit of measures (UOMs). These custom UOMs must be mapped to standard UOM codes. The UOM Code to Standard UOM Mapping extendable lookup is used for this purpose. Each value defined for the UOM Code to Standard UOM Mapping extendable lookup should include the following:
Head-end UOM: The unit of measure code used by the head-end system.
Unit of Measure: The unit of measure defined in the system.
Description: A description of the unit of measure code.
